Choosing the Right Motorcycle


Selecting the right motorcycle for your adventure is crucial for a comfortable and enjoyable ride. Here are some factors to consider when choosing a motorcycle:


Riding Experience


Your level of experience should guide your choice of motorcycle. If you are a beginner, consider starting with a smaller, lighter bike that is easier to handle. For experienced riders, larger touring bikes or cruisers may be more suitable.


Type of Trip


Think about the type of trip you are planning. Are you looking for a leisurely ride along the coast or an adventurous journey through the mountains? Different motorcycles are designed for different terrains, so choose one that fits your itinerary.


Comfort and Fit


Make sure to test ride the motorcycle before renting it. Comfort is key, especially for long rides. Ensure that you can reach the handlebars and foot pegs comfortably and that the seat height is appropriate for you.


Top Scenic Routes for Motorcycle Riding


Once you have your motorcycle, it’s time to hit the road! Here are some of the most scenic routes in the US that are perfect for motorcycle adventures:


1. Pacific Coast Highway, California


The Pacific Coast Highway (PCH) is one of the most iconic motorcycle routes in the US. Stretching along the California coastline, this route offers breathtaking views of the ocean, cliffs, and charming coastal towns.


  • Must-See Stops:

- Big Sur

- Hearst Castle

- Santa Barbara


2. Blue Ridge Parkway, Virginia and North Carolina


The Blue Ridge Parkway is renowned for its stunning mountain vistas and vibrant fall foliage. This route is perfect for leisurely rides, with plenty of overlooks and picnic areas.


  • Must-See Stops:

- Mabry Mill

- Linville Falls

- Craggy Gardens

Preparing for Your Motorcycle Adventure


Before you hit the road, it’s essential to prepare adequately for your motorcycle adventure. Here are some tips to ensure a smooth ride:


Safety Gear


Invest in quality safety gear, including a helmet, gloves, jacket, and boots. Wearing the right gear can significantly reduce the risk of injury in case of an accident.


Route Planning


Plan your route in advance, taking into account the distance, road conditions, and weather. Use apps or GPS devices to help navigate and find the best roads.


Check the Motorcycle


Before starting your journey, perform a quick inspection of the motorcycle. Check the tire pressure, brakes, lights, and fluid levels to ensure everything is in good working order.


Renting a Motorcycle: What to Expect


When renting a motorcycle, it’s essential to understand the rental process and what to expect. Here’s a breakdown of the typical rental experience:


Reservation Process


Most rental companies allow you to reserve a motorcycle online. You will need to provide your driver's license, credit card information, and possibly a motorcycle endorsement.


Rental Agreement


Read the rental agreement carefully before signing. Pay attention to the terms regarding mileage limits, insurance coverage, and any additional fees.


Return Policy


Understand the return policy, including the condition in which the motorcycle should be returned and any potential charges for late returns or damages.
